 What Is MidasIT?

MidasIT is a leading engineering software developer specializing in solutions for civil, structural, and geotechnical engineering. Originating from South Korea, the company has expanded its footprint globally, supporting engineers in designing bridges, buildings, tunnels, and complex infrastructure systems. We recognize MidasIT for combining mathematical rigor with user-friendly interfaces, enabling engineers to simulate real-world behavior with exceptional accuracy while maintaining efficiency throughout the design process.

Core MidasIT Software Products

Midas Civil for Structural and Bridge Engineering

Midas Civil is one of the most widely used products in the MidasIT portfolio. We rely on it for advanced structural analysis and design of bridges, highways, and transportation structures. The software supports nonlinear analysis, staged construction simulation, time-dependent material behavior, and seismic analysis. These features allow engineers to model realistic construction sequences and long-term structural performance with confidence.

Midas Gen for Building Structures

Midas Gen is designed for building structures, offering tools for reinforced concrete and steel design. We value its ability to handle high-rise buildings, industrial facilities, and complex load conditions. The software integrates international design codes, enabling engineers to comply with regional regulations while maintaining design efficiency.

Midas GTS NX for Geotechnical Analysis

For underground and soil-structure interaction projects, Midas GTS NX delivers powerful geotechnical analysis capabilities. We use it to simulate excavation stages, tunnel behavior, slope stability, and foundation performance. Its finite element modeling ensures accurate representation of soil conditions and construction impacts.
